Basil Vinaigrette Salad Dressing

A tangy tasting salad dressing that gives your greens a fresh appeal while imparting a beautiful celadon tint to your vegetables. A wonderful way to use up the extra basil leaves.
Prep Time10 minutes
Total Time10 minutes
Course: Salad
Cuisine: American
Servings: 8
Calories: 61kcal

Ingredients

  • ¾ cup fresh lemon juice
  • cup white balsamic vinegar
  • 1 cup fresh basil leaves
  • c. Dijon mustard
  • 1 ½ cups ext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 ½ teaspoons salt
  • 1 Tablespoon pepper
  • 1 ½ teaspoon garlic powder

Instructions

  • Add everything except olive oil to a blender and puree. Slowly add the olive oil to the basil mixture so it will emulsify and blend thoroughly.
  • Store in refrigerator.

Notes

  • You can use red wine vinegar in place of the white balsamic but we found it a bit acidic and had to add a teaspoon of honey. The white balsamic is the perfect blend for us -- just a touch of sweetness and less acidic.
